Abstract
According to ethnobotanical data, Pinus species have been used against rheumatic pain and for wound healing in Turkish folk medicine. In the present study, the essential oils obtained from the cones of Pinus pinea and Pinus halepensis demonstrated the highest effects on the wound healing activity models.
